The result wasn't bad, though I don't think I did my best work. I had to wait two hours with other people giving arguments before we argued. I was calm at the bench but nervous speaking. They didn't say anything unexpected, and I forgot one of my points, but I still think we should win. I have a huge stomach ache now.
The thing with litigation is the pressure is not the fear of public speaking, but the pressure not to let down your client who relies on you as their advocate. In the court of appeals level it's worse because you know that the decision may affect not only your client but others in their position in the future.

I've done a ton of presentations, oral technical defenses and similar public speaking. No, it isn't speaking in front of Judges but peer reveiws and presenting technical stuff to either tech or non-tech people is still stressful at times.
To be quite honest, I still get butterflies. Just keep in mind, no one I have presented for seems to notice. *You* may feel nervous but that doesn't necessarily translate into your delivery. That and normally I feel just fine about two minutes into the thing.
Just make sure you are prepared and psych yourself up a bit. There is no magic trick to public speaking and many of the best speakers ever all said they were nervous as hell before even a simple engagement. Celeris Tujimson
